What is a GRL Busbar System?

A grl busbar is a prefabricated electrical distribution system. It consists of metal bars or conductors housed inside a protective enclosure, designed to carry significant electrical current with minimal loss. Unlike traditional cabling, busbars offer a streamlined and robust method for power transmission.

Core Design and Engineering Principles

The superior performance of a GRL busbar stems from its intelligent design. Key elements include high-conductivity copper or aluminum bars, compact and modular housing, and advanced insulation materials. This design ensures optimal electrical characteristics, thermal management, and mechanical strength.

Electrical Performance and Safety Features

GRL busbars are engineered for low impedance, reducing voltage drop and power loss. Safety is integrated through features like fully insulated conductors, which significantly lower the risk of short circuits and electric shock, creating a safer environment for personnel and equipment.

Primary Applications Across Industries

The versatility of GRL busbar systems makes them ideal for diverse settings. They are a cornerstone in data centers for reliable server power, essential in industrial manufacturing plants to feed heavy machinery, and increasingly used in commercial buildings for flexible floor-by-floor power distribution.

Enhancing Data Center Infrastructure

In mission-critical data centers, GRL busbars provide scalable, redundant power paths to server racks. Their modular nature allows for easy reconfiguration as IT loads change, supporting high-density computing without the clutter and fire risks associated with cable trays.

Key Benefits Over Traditional Wiring

Adopting a GRL busbar system delivers tangible advantages. It offers greater energy efficiency through reduced losses, enhanced safety, and superior space savings. Installation is faster, and the system’s scalability future-proofs your electrical infrastructure, allowing for easy expansion.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Q)

Q: How does a GRL busbar improve energy efficiency?
A: Its low-impedance design and superior conductivity minimize power loss as heat during transmission, leading to direct energy savings and lower operating costs.

Q: Can a busbar system be modified after installation?
A: Yes. One of the major benefits is modularity. Tap-off points allow you to add, remove, or relocate power connections quickly without system downtime.

Q: Are GRL busbars suitable for hazardous locations?
A> Specific designs with appropriate ingress protection (IP) ratings and enclosures are available for harsh or hazardous industrial environments.
